Upsides to an Immediate Date of Entry
- Speedy Settling: Instantly gaining possession can be a lifesaver if you’re between leases or starting a new job in Israel.
- Negotiation Opportunities: Landlords seeking immediate occupancy might be more flexible on rent, deposit terms, or minor repairs if it seals the deal quickly.
- Minimal Overlap: If timed perfectly, you avoid paying rent in two places at once.
Challenges to Manage
- Limited Inspection Time: In the rush for immediate occupancy, a thorough check of the property might be overlooked. Always do a brief but systematic walk-through.
- Rapid Paperwork: Signing a lease or purchase contract with minimal lead time demands attention to detail to ensure no hidden clauses or fees.
- Utility Switchover: Water, electricity, and Arnona registration can be urgent tasks when you’re moving in almost overnight.
Final Thought
Immediate entries are perfect for self-starters who can pivot fast and handle logistical tasks at a moment’s notice. Just remember to keep a paper trail and, if possible, confirm that major systems (air conditioning, plumbing, etc.) are in working order before you sign anything.
